Hannah Tame : a Story. By the Author of "Mr.

Greysmith." (Macmillan and Co.)—Though "Hannah" is but twelve years old when her adventures begin, they are of a kind to interest those chiefly who are beyond childhood. The account of her sojourn in Germany is well told, and true to the manners of the country. "Cousin Ada's " vulgar affectation of French phrases is carried rather too far, to be equally true to the manners even of would-be fine ladies in England ; but on the whole, it is a nice little tale, and well

written. •
